Rickmansworth – Home Leg

Result: 2½ – 3½ Loss

The first (home) leg of this year’s match against Rickmansworth Golf Club took place on an afternoon of sunshine and heavy showers. Kerry Sargeant and Graeme Syme had an easy win (6&5) but the other five matches were very closely fought affairs that, with different play on the 18th hole, could have seen us take a 4-2 lead, rather than a 1 point deficit, to the away leg. The Dysart Arms was the venue for the after match dinner.

Anyone who would like to play in the return match at ‘Tricky Ricky’ on August 18th , and help us retain the trophy we won last year, should get their name down when the sheet appears in a few weeks time.

Club Championship Round 1

Posted in Competitions

LADIES

Club Championship
After a stunning gross score of 89 (net 65, six shots under her handicap), Jayne Maxwell lies in 2nd place in the Ladies’ Club Championship, only 2 shots behind Julie Smith. Angela Flynn is in 3rd place (gross 93). R1 Leader board…

Handicap Cup
In the Handicap Cup for handicaps 0-24, Jayne has a 9 shot lead over the rest of the field going into the second round. Julie Smith is in 2nd place (net 74) and Cheryl Woodhouse in 3rd (75). R1 Leader board…

Pembroke Cup
Playing to two shots under her handicap, Ros Gray leads in the Pembroke Cup (for handicaps 25-36) on net 69. A new club member, Susan Smith, is in 2nd (74) with Norma Lynch & Jini Beacham joint 3rd in the first round standings (79). R1 Leader board…

The CSS remained at 71. Ladies handicap list…

MEN

Ian Smith leads the Club Championship with a very creditable 72 in a slow placed round, three ahead of Paul Appleton and seven from Rob Urquhart. Senior R1 Leader board…

The returns are very close in the Junior Division where Richard Kenwood is one ahead of Stuart Nash, two ahead of Paul Grand and three ahead of Tony Archdale. Junior R1 Leader board…

The order was reversed in the handicap competition with Paul Appleton returning a net 64, two ahead of Ian Smith and Arthur Dolby. Handicap R1 Leader board…

CSS was unchanged @ 68 from SSS. Men’s handicap list…

Whitewebbs – Team A Rd 1 at Bird Hills

Result: 4-1 Loss

We played our second round match of the White Webbs on Saturday 16th at Bird Hills near the very pretty village of Holyport.

Unfortunately we were beaten convincingly 4-1 with our only success being Lorna who gave 20 shots but still managed to win her game. Well done Lorna!! and thanks to Maureen, Ros L and Veronica for playing for the team.
